I got a 2010 Accord LX-P with 16inch rims no more than 5 days ago. I have driven the car about 260 some miles and I will say that coming from a 1998 Camry V6 with shocks and springs that are shot, it is indeed stiffer, but never uncomfortable. I actually like the solid ride quality because it feels, dare I say, sporty . I am guessing that after about 1500-2000 miles the suspension will become more settled, but I don't know if it will ever be mushy. I don't know how harsh your car rides but maybe there is something wrong with your cars suspension, if something is up, I am sure Honda will fix it under the warranty. Or maybe you are used to softer riding cars and this stiff ride is not of your liking.
